armenian

10 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. a. Of or pertaining to Armenia.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. A native or one of the people of Armenia; also, the language of the Armenians. Source: opted
  3. 3. n. An adherent of the Armenian Church, an organization similar in some doctrines and practices to the Greek Church, in others to the Roman Catholic. Source: opted
  4. 4. adj. of or pertaining to Armenia or the people or culture of Armenia Source: wordnet
  5. 5. n. a native or inhabitant of Armenia Source: wordnet
  6. 6. n. the Indo-European language spoken predominantly in Armenia, but also in Azerbaijan Source: wordnet
  7. 7. n. a writing system having an alphabet of 38 letters in which the Armenian language is written Source: wordnet
  8. 8. Of or pertaining to Armenia. Armenian bole, a soft clayey earth of a bright red color found in Armenia, Tuscany, etc. -- Armenian stone. (a) The commercial name of lapis lazuli. (b) Emery. 1.
